
SEBI Orders Personal Hearing in High-Stakes Investigation Against Arpan Gupta in Sharpline Broadcast Matter
The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) has issued a formal notice mandating a personal hearing regarding an investigation involving Arpan Gupta concerning Sharpline Broadcast Limited. This regulatory action signals the continuation of oversight into the matter that originated from a previous Show Cause Notice.Mandate for Personal Hearing in Regulatory Case
The notification confirms that Arpan Gupta, identified as the noticee, has been granted a further opportunity to present his case before the Quasi Judicial Authority. This decision follows initial proceedings related to the incident involving Sharpline Broadcast Limited. The regulatory process is being conducted by SEBI's Assistant General Manager Integrated Surveillance Department.The hearing is formally scheduled for July 27, 2026, at 14:30 PM. The matter will be heard before Shri Santosh Kumar Shukla (Quasi Judicial Authority). This subsequent action relates to the Show Cause Notice (SCN) originally served on March 28, 2024.
Details of the SEBI Hearing Venue
The hearing is scheduled to take place at the official premises of SEBI in Mumbai. The venue specified for all participants is SEBI Bhavan Il, located at PN-C/7, G Block BKC, Bandra Kurla Complex, Bandra East, Mumbai, Maharashtra 400051.Participants are strictly advised to ensure proper preparation ahead of the scheduled date. All concerned parties must be fully briefed on the necessary documentation and procedural requirements set forth by SEBI.
Compliance Requirements and Consequences of Non-Appearance
The notice places stringent compliance duties upon Arpan Gupta, requiring him to ensure that any person authorized to appear for the hearing brings both the original documents and a copy of the Notice. An alternative option is available for those who prefer remote participation via video conferencing.It must be noted by all parties that failure to attend the scheduled hearing will be interpreted as having nothing further to state in this matter. In such an event, SEBI has stated it will proceed with the investigation based solely on the material currently available on record.
The notice concludes by requiring the recipient to acknowledge receipt and confirm their attendance date via email or letter addressed to the designated officials at sapatra@sebi.gov.in.
